About Puma Se

PUMA SE is a global leader in the design, development, marketing, and sale of footwear, clothing, and accessories. The company caters to a diverse customer base, including men, women, and children, across various regions worldwide.

Products and Services
  • High-performance athletic gear for sports like football, running, and golf
  • Lifestyle apparel influenced by sports trends
  • Licensed products including watches, eyewear, and gaming accessories
